## Further reading

This module wraps the Cindervale pool manager and enforces per-tenant connection caps. Reviewers should know that pool sizing is deliberately conservative: the Orrin cluster tops out at 200 connections, and exceeding it degrades everything sharing the primary. Timeouts, retry semantics, and the reasoning behind the leak detector are documented in depth elsewhere rather than duplicated in code comments. For the full design rationale and tuning guidance, see the internal page here.

wiki page, tahaf-tajog: https://jira.ordindyn.corp/pipeline

Handover — Second-Source Supplier Search

To the incoming director: Velmark Components remains our sole supplier for the Korrin valve line. Risk flagged twice last quarter. I shortlisted three alternates — Drayfeld Industrial, Oster & Pell, and Tannavik Works. Drayfeld passed initial audit; the other two pending. Samples due end of month. Keep Procurement's Lena Vos in the loop; she owns the scoring matrix. Do not signal exclusivity to Velmark until a second source is signed. Context on the broader plan follows below.

management briefing: The renewal with Zoraelax Group closes at $10 million a year, 15 percent below the last contract. Project Ralael slips by six weeks because of the audit delay.

## Who to ping about GiftNote

Welcome aboard! GiftNote is our donation-receipt mailer for the Larchfield Fund. Template tweaks go to the comms folks; delivery failures and bounce weirdness go to the platform crew. Don't push template changes on Fridays — receipts batch over the weekend. For anything GiftNote-related, start with the address below.

billing contact of kaweg-tajeg = drudor.lamion.oliath@torvalabs.test

Support should know that suggestions now respect the customer's region setting, so Caldermoor users will no longer see Norrish-format addresses. If a customer reports stale suggestions, have them clear the widget cache from settings before escalating. When filing an escalation, quote the build token shown directly below this item.

pipeline stamp: htk9_ce63042d9